Key differences

BBLU is an equity ETF, while NBGX is an alternative ETF. BBLU charges 0.15% a year and NBGX 0.44%.

  • BBLU is an equity fund, while NBGX is an alternative fund. They carry different risk/return profiles.
  • BBLU follows a active selection strategy; NBGX uses option income.
  • BBLU costs 0.29% less per year.
  • BBLU is much larger than NBGX. Larger funds are usually more liquid and less likely to close.
  • BBLU has a longer track record, which may reduce uncertainty around long-term behavior.
